How do I get ants out of the lawn?

The nests can be relocated using a clay pot filled with wood shavings or loose soil. Since ants do not like certain scents, they can be repelled with lavender blossoms, cinnamon, cloves, chilli powder or lemon peel, for example, by sprinkling the substances on ant nests and streets.

Can ants destroy the lawn?

The ants with their nests do not actually cause any damage in the lawn. Sometimes it can happen that the grass roots in the nest area no longer have any contact with the ground because the soil in the nest is so finely crumbly.

Can you get rid of ants with coffee grounds?

Yes, coffee or coffee grounds really do help repel ants. The strong smell of coffee disturbs the orientation of the ants and they can no longer follow their scent trail. The ants will not disappear completely by using coffee grounds. But most of the ants are driven away.

How do I use baking soda against ants?

One of the most popular home remedies for ants is the tried and tested baking soda. Mix a packet of the powder with a suitable attractant such as sugar. The mixture is then scattered where the ants are often seen. Ants eat the mixture and die.

How deep is an ant nest in the ground?

The depth of the nests is usually ½ to 1 meter, and the queen cannot go any deeper.

What kills ants but not the grass?

Ant baits and granulated ant poison are two of the most effective ways to kill ant colonies without harming your grass. Alternatively, you can flatten ant hills to drive ants out without any harm to your yard.

What is the fastest way to get rid of red ants?

Pouring 2 to 3 gallons of very hot or boiling water on the mound will kill ants about 60% of the time. Otherwise, the ants will probably just move to another location. Very hot or boiling water will kill the grass or surrounding vegetation that it is poured upon.
